单片机存储器配置:
片内RAM 128字节(00H—7FH);
片内RAM前32个单元是工作寄存器区(00H—1FH)
片内RAM有128个可按位寻址的位,占16个单元。
位地址编号为:00H—7FH,分布在20H—2FH单元(P.27)
片内21个特殊功能寄存器(SFR)中:地址号能被 8整除的 SFR中的各位也可按位寻址(P.27-28)
可寻址片外RAM 64K字节 (0000H—FFFFH)
可寻址片外ROM 64K字节 (0000H—FFFFH)
片内 ROM 4K字节 (000H—FFFH)
扩展阅读:半导体存储器
存储器配置(片内RAM)
1、片内RAM 128字节(00H—7FH)
2、片内RAM前32个单元是工作寄存器区 (00H—1FH)
3、片内RAM前32个单元是工作寄存器区 (00H—1FH)
4、片内RAM中有128个可按位寻址的位。[page]
位地址:00H—7FH
分布在:20H—2FH单元
5、片内RAM中有128个可按位寻址的位。
位地址:00H—7FH
分布在:20H—2FH单元
6、可寻址片外RAM 64K字节 (0000H—FFFFH);
可寻址片外ROM 64K字节 (0000H—FFFFH);
片内 ROM 4K字节 ( 000H— FFFH);
关键字:单片机 存储器 寄存器
引用地址:
单片机存储器的配置
推荐阅读最新更新时间:2024-03-16 13:17
基于DSP+MCU的列车滚动轴承故障诊断系统设计与应用
滚动轴承是列车转动机件的支撑,也是铁路车辆上最容易危及行车安全的易损件。由于工作面接触应力的长期反复作用,极易引起轴承疲劳、裂纹、压痕等故障,导致轴承断裂,造成重大事故。轴承工作状态是否正常,对于列车的安全有着重大的影响。因此,开展列车滚动轴承故障诊断的研究对避免重大事故、促进经济发展具有相当大的意义。 1 系统总体设计 1.1 硬件系统 振动控制系统是一个典型的实时信号处理系统,需要对较复杂的信号进行处理。考虑到单片机的控制功能强,其总线位数少,运行速度相对较慢;而DSP(Digital Signal Processor)的运算能力强,总线宽度宽,控制功能相对较弱。为了提高系统的信号处理速度,便于对系统的
[单片机]
在STM32F103C8微控制器中使用RS-485串行通信
通信协议是数字电子和嵌入式系统的组成部分。只要有多个微控制器和外围设备的接口,就必须使用通信协议来交换大量数据。有多种类型的串行通信协议可用。RS485 是串行通信协议之一,用于工业项目和重型机械。 本教程是关于在 STM32F103C8 微控制器中使用RS-485 串行通信。 在本教程中,Master STM32F103C8 具有三个按钮,用于通过使用 RS-485 串行通信来控制 Slave Arduino Uno 上的三个 LED 的状态。 RS-485 串行通讯 RS-485 是一种不需要时钟的异步串行通信协议。它使用一种称为差分信号的技术将二进制数据从一个设备传输到另一个设备。 那么这种差
[单片机]
用单片机控制的流水灯设计
1.引言 当今时代是一个新技术层出不穷的时代,在电子领域尤其是自动化智能控制领域,传统的分立元件或数字逻辑电路构成的控制系统,正以前所未见的速度被单片机智能控制系统所取代。单片机具有体积小、功能强、成本低、应用面广等优点,可以说,智能控制与自动控制的核心就是单片机。目前,一个学习与应用单片机的高潮正在工厂、学校及企事业单位大规模地兴起。学习单片机的最有效方法就是理论与实践并重,本文笔者用AT89C51单片机自制了一款简易的流水灯,重点介绍了其软件编程方法,以期给单片机初学者以启发,更快地成为单片机领域的优秀人才。 2.硬件组成 按照单片机系统扩展与系统配置状况,单片机应用系统可分为最小系统、最小功耗系统及典型
[单片机]
我们用C语言写的单片机程序存在哪
首先,我们看看ram与rom的特点与区别: RAM速度比Rom快,但断电后信息就消失; ROM速度比RAM慢,但断电后信息还存在; 一般而言,RAM可以随时写入信息,ROM不可以随时写入,当然像Flash Rom之类是可以随时写入的。 综上,我们会把程序存入ROM中,这样程序就一直存在。 例如,我所用的zigbee协议栈中的代码量统计情况如下: **************************************** * *
[单片机]
铁电存储器在无线公话上的应用方案的介绍
随着社会的发展,无线公用电话的应用范围越来越广,它有着固定电话的实惠费用,又有移动电话的方便.在一些不方便布线的居住区或者移动办公的场所与固定电话有着无法比拟的优势.如在比较偏僻的农村,布线的费用昂贵,用无线公话就实惠很多.如果把无线公话用在公司,它就不用担心因公司的般迁而来引起换号码的麻烦!关于无线公话的方案也是工程师关心的问题.
无线公话的方案基本的方案常见有以下三种:
1> 小容量缓存的MCU+铁电存储器
2> 大容量缓存的MCU+EEPROM
3> 小容量缓存的MCU+SRAM+EEPROM
现在介绍两套关于无线公话的典型的应用方案:
1) 1SST89C58+FRAM;
2) 2)SST89C554+EEPRO
[应用]
单片机数码管显示数字递增
让单片机的数码管显示的数从0开始递增一直到255,然后重新置0,再递增,如此循环. 还是用到了将要显示的数进行百位,十位,个位的分离. 从这篇开始,以后的程序就要注意程序的规范性,与可读性了.源代码如下(已经成功调通): #include reg52.h #define uint unsigned int #define uchar unsigned char sbit sda = P1^0; sbit clk = P1^1; sbit dig1 = P1^2; sbit dig2 = P1^3; sbit dig3 = P1^4; sbit dig4 = P1^ 5; uchar code table ={0x7e,0x0
[单片机]
单片机STM32时钟设计分析
STM32互连型系列产品分为两个型号: STM32F105和STM32F107。STM32F105具有USB OTG 和CAN2.0B接口。STM32F107在USB OTG 和CAN2.0B接口基础上增加了以太网10/100 MAC模块 。片上集成的以太网MAC支持MII和RMII,因此,实现一个完整的以太网收发器只需一个外部PHY芯片。只使用一个25MHz晶振即可给整个微控制器提供时钟频率,包括以太网和USB OTG外设接口。微控制器还能产生一个25MHz或50MHz的时钟输出,驱动外部以太网PHY层芯片,从而为客户节省了一个附加晶振。 音频功能方面,新系列微控制器提供两个I2S音频接口,支持主机和从机两种模式,既
[单片机]
stc12c5a60s2复位电路说明
STC12C5A60S2在众多的51系列单片机中,要算国内STC 公司的1T增强系列更具有竞争力,因他不但和8051指令、管脚完全兼容,而且其片内的具有大容量程序存储器且是FLASH工艺的,如STC12C5A60S2单片机内部就自带高达60K FLASHROM,这种工艺的存储器用户可以用电的方式瞬间擦除、改写。而且STC系列单片机支持串口程序烧写。显而易见,这种单片机对开发设备的要求很低,开发时间也大大缩短。写入单片机内的程序还可以进行加密,这又很好地保护了你的劳动成果。 stc12c5a60s2内部结构图 stc12c5a60s2内部结构图如下: stc12c5a60s2复位电路 就是在复位引脚接1个10UF电容到电源+,
[单片机]